C# OrchardCMS是一个开源的内容管理系统,它基于ASP.NET MVC框架和C#语言开发。它提供了一个灵活的平台,可以帮助开发人员快速构建和管理各种类型的网站和应用程序。
动态启用功能是OrchardCMS的一个重要特性,它允许用户在不修改代码的情况下,通过简单的配置来启用或禁用特定的功能模块。这样的设计使得网站的功能管理变得非常灵活和可扩展。
优势:
- 灵活性:动态启用功能使得网站的功能管理变得非常灵活,用户可以根据实际需求选择启用或禁用特定的功能模块,而无需修改代码。
- 可扩展性:OrchardCMS提供了丰富的功能模块和插件,用户可以根据自己的需求选择性地启用这些功能,从而实现网站的功能扩展。
- 简化开发:通过动态启用功能,开发人员可以更加专注于核心业务逻辑的开发,而无需关注功能模块的启用和管理。
应用场景:
- 企业网站:企业网站通常需要具备不同的功能模块,如新闻发布、产品展示、在线购物等。通过动态启用功能,可以根据企业的需求选择性地启用这些功能模块,从而快速构建一个功能完善的企业网站。
- 社区论坛:社区论坛需要具备用户管理、帖子管理、评论管理等功能。通过动态启用功能,可以根据论坛的需求选择性地启用这些功能模块,从而打造一个功能丰富的社区论坛。
- 博客平台:博客平台需要具备文章管理、标签管理、评论管理等功能。通过动态启用功能,可以根据博客平台的需求选择性地启用这些功能模块,从而构建一个功能强大的博客平台。
推荐的腾讯云相关产品:
腾讯云提供了一系列与云计算相关的产品和服务,以下是一些推荐的产品:
- 云服务器(CVM):提供灵活可扩展的云服务器实例,适用于各种规模的网站和应用程序。
- 云数据库MySQL版(CDB):提供高性能、可扩展的云数据库服务,适用于存储和管理网站和应用程序的数据。
- 云存储(COS):提供安全可靠的云存储服务,适用于存储和管理网站和应用程序的静态资源。
- 人工智能(AI):提供各种人工智能相关的服务,如语音识别、图像识别等,可以应用于网站和应用程序的智能化处理。
- 物联网(IoT):提供物联网相关的服务,如设备管理、数据采集等,可以应用于物联网相关的网站和应用程序。
更多关于腾讯云产品的介绍和详细信息,您可以访问腾讯云官方网站:https://cloud.tencent.com/